The height of the tree is 249.5 feet
<h3>How to determine the height of the tree?</h3>
The given parameters are:
- Elevation angle = 80 degrees
- Shadow length (L) = 44 feet
Let the height of the tree be x.
So, we have:
tan(80) = x/44
Multiply both sides by 44
x = 44 * tan(80)
Evaluate
x = 249.5
Hence, the height of the tree is 249.5 feet

First, you want to solve for the equation for this problem, would be:
0.05N + 0.10D = 20.50
While N = The amount of nickels, and D = The amount of dimes.
Since N = 164, and D = 123. It would add up to 287 coins. 164 + 123 = 287.
Now that you have the number for those two variables, solve the equation for when N = 164, and D = 123.
0.05N + 0.10D = 20.50
<span>0.05(164) + 0.10(123) = 20.50
</span><span>8.2 + 12.3 = 20.50
</span>20.50 = 20.50
So, there is 164 nickels, and 123 dimes for your answer.
